Please note that this is for you standard 3 mob pull (or more) and is not focused on damage.
Mana is now mitigation due to "The Blackest Night". The 2400 MP used for the ability will give me a 10k shield with my health pool, this is more than what a DA souleater will heal me for (SE is about a 3400 heal in my gear). Also for reference, a DA abyssal drain will heal me for about 1100 per target.
The rotation is pretty simple, after you have gathered all of the mobs and dumped your initial mana into the The Blackest Night and DA abyssal drain spam, you will hard slash into syphon stike while NOT doing a souleater to finish the combo. In terms of mana you will prioritize using "The Blackest Night" on CD followed by a DA abyssal drain after your syphon strike. You will also completely ignore the blood gauge (outside of Delirium). The reasoning is because there is no threat modifier on Quietus and it is on the GCD. I also save C+S for the MP regen as well.
